Regional Operations Director - Virginia

VCA Animal Hospitals is seeking a Regional Operations Director for their Mid-Atlantic group to oversee operations and support an exceptional medical environment across the region. The role involves driving hospital success, guiding teams, and partnering with medical and operational leaders to ensure business growth and outstanding patient care.

Responsibilities

Ensure VCA’s standards of quality medical practice and customer service are followed in all hospitals. Improve workflow and staff efficiency, review hospital hours and doctor appointment availability, create and maintain hospital environments dedicated to client/patient satisfaction, and handle non-medical client complaints
Develop strong relationships with Medical Directors and Hospital Managers. Inspire an “owner mentality” to implement programs that support the broad business strategy and hospital results and assist with the training of Medical Directors and Hospital Managers in customer service skills, business operations, and effective staff meetings
Cultivate a healthy culture and manage performance to foster staff morale, engagement, and retention, ensuring compliance with federal and state employment laws and regulations. Conduct performance reviews and terminations of Hospital Managers/Office Managers and Medical Directors. Support Hospital Managers to hire doctors for the region’s hospitals, train, educate, develop, and promote hospital management and paraprofessional staff
Drive hospital revenue growth, evaluate service and product fees, audit hospital production for accuracy, implement price increases, and manage discount policies and invoice audits
Ensure VCA standards of cash control are followed, evaluate auditing and reporting methods, utilize hospital financial and quality care reports to drive performance, monitor expenditures and payroll, and review inventory and training staff on leveraging purchases
Work with the local Marketing Manager to keep hospital marketing current, support VCA’s marketing events and programs, train hospital staff on new marketing initiatives, and review internal marketing strategies
Ensure VCA culture is embedded in hospitals, maintain a team atmosphere, and work closely with other field leadership team members to ensure operational consistency and best practices

Required

Leadership experience in a multi-site operational business, preferably in healthcare or related industries
Strong financial acumen with proven experience managing P&L and driving revenue growth
Demonstrated success in building and leading high-performing teams
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to engage and influence Medical Directors and other healthcare professionals
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ment, managing multiple priorities under pressure

Preferred

Bachelor's degree highly preferred; MBA, DVM, or a degree in Healthcare or Hospital Management is a plus but not required
